Residential towers planned for 2014 Olympics host city

A massive, 1.2 million-sf residential and retail complex is planned for Sochi, Russia, host city of the XXII Olympic and Paralympic Winter Games in 2014. Chicago-based architect Built Form recently won the competition to design the project, which will include two 30-story towers comprising 650 residences, 100,000 sf of retail, and 200,000 sf of parking. Built Form will work with Serbian construction manager Putevi and Russian developer Imperial to create the structures. Completion: 2010.
